Output 287fb0deeef780225598e579df993f3ba1919e3422a7dd903ca251527ca7ab64:7

value
1697593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31c483ebb174d910b8099aac14347cc50e34687 OP_EQUAL
address
3NPsCAu4bEh8vmuoKYiddcEfzHTJsqvahD
transaction
287fb0deeef780225598e579df993f3ba1919e3422a7dd903ca251527ca7ab64
confirmations
367651
spent
true